Definition

A foster family provides a temporary home for children whose biological parents are unable to care for them. They offer a safe and nurturing environment. Unlike adoption, foster care is not permanent; the goal is often reunification with the child's original family. Think of it like a temporary pit stop on a longer journey. Foster families can provide stability and support during a challenging time. They make a huge difference in a child's life by offering love and care.

Etymology

The word "foster" comes from Old English "fostrian," meaning "to nourish, cherish, bring up." It's related to "food" and reflects the idea of providing sustenance and care. The term has been used for centuries to describe nurturing relationships outside of the immediate family. The modern usage of "foster family" highlights the temporary nature of this caregiving role, emphasizing a supportive and nurturing environment.
